terça-feira, 18 de novembro de 2014

Armazenamento de dados no Google App Engine

Mais um informativo dos recursos do Google App Engine... Dessa vez, sucintamente sobre banco de dados.

http://d3a0avt069wzkc.cloudfront.net/sep_2010_vibrations/images/bigtable.jpg



O armazenamento de dados no Google App Engine não é um banco de dados relacional. O serviço de armazenamento de dados do Google App Engine é baseado no BigTable [Chang et al. 2006], um sistema distribuído de armazenamento de dados em larga escala. O BigTable funciona como um banco de dados orientado a colunas e utiliza o GFS (Google File System) para gerenciar informações, podendo ser utilizado juntamente como o MapReduce para distribuir o processamento dos dados.

As aplicações desenvolvidas para o App Engine serão executadas no Google, que realiza, caso necessário, o dimensionamento automaticamente. O Google oferece um serviço gratuito limitado e utiliza critérios de uso diário e contas por minuto para calcular o preço para aplicações que exigem um serviço profissional.

Referência:
SOUZA, R. C. Flávio; MOREIRA, Leonardo O.; MACHADO, Javam C.Computação em Nuvem: Conceitos, Tecnologias, Aplicações e Desafios. Disponível em: <http://www.ufpi.br/subsiteFiles/ercemapi/arquivos/files/minicurso/mc7.pdf>. Acesso em: 18 de novembro de 2014.


 

Nenhum comentário:

Postar um comentário